Coolant Temperature Sensor/Switch (For Computer): Testing and Inspection

REMOVING AND INSTALLING CHECKING TEMPERATURE SENSOR FOR COOLANT





- The temperature sensor measures the engine temperature and sends this information to the control unit as a resistance value.
- The resistance value drops with rising temperature (NTC).
1 = Plug connection
2 = Housing
3 = NTC resistor

Removing and Installing





- Pull off plug (1).
- Unscrew temperature sensor.


Installation Note:





- Check code number (1).
- Replace seal (2).
FD = Manufacturing date
- Fill and bleed cooling system.

Checking:





- Connect Jetronic test lead 61 1 440.
- Check nominal value with an ohmmeter.
- To check the entire temperature range, remove temperature sensor, place it in a water bath heated to testing temperature and check resistance with an ohmmeter.

-. Resistance should be as follows:

70000 - 11,600 ohms at 14°F,
2100 - 2900 ohms at 68°F,
270 - 400 ohms at 176°F.

-. If resistance is not within specifications, sensor is defective.
